According to a study published by "Spectrochimica acta. Part A, Molecular and biomolecular spectroscopy", the tuber of Dioscorea fordii is one of 4 Dioscorea species studied. The research involved a total of 107 Dioscorea spp. tuber samples collected from different locations in China. These tubers are sometimes used as adulterants in the commercial market. While PCA was unable to differentiate the species effectively, PCA-Class and OPLS-DA can distinguish the tubers with high accuracy, sensitivity, and specificity. The OPLS-DA model showed low RMSEE, RMSEP, and RMSECV values.
